Skip to content

HackUCF/Benzene-DNS

Folders and files

NameName
Last commit message
Last commit date

Latest commit

 

History

2 Commits
 
 
 
 
 
 
 
 
 
 

Repository files navigation

DNS C2 Client and Server

Configure

  1. Deploy server.py somewhere.
  2. Set the remote_address variable in agent.py
  3. Distribute and execute agent.py
  4. You now have a functioning C2 infrastructure!

Send commands

Use the server.py C2 console to run commands on all connected agents.

File transfer is theoretical, but not fully implemented for this academic proof-of-concept.

About

A hard-to-detect DNS-based command-and-control agent and server.

Resources

License

Stars

Watchers

Forks

Releases

No releases published

Packages

No packages published

Languages